Slovenia’s New Government Lifts Ban on Arms Sales to Israel

Israeli soldiers work on their tanks in a staging area on the border with Gaza Strip, in southern Israel, Tuesday, July 29, 2025

BELGRADE (Sputnik) — The new Slovenian government, led by the Slovenian Democratic Party (SDS), has lifted the ban on arms and military equipment sales to Israel, the cabinet said. On June 4, the Slovenian Parliament approved by a majority vote the new government led by Janez Jansa and his SDS. «The Government of the Republic of Slovenia has adopted a resolution repealing the resolution of July 31, 2025.
